What Unique Flavors Do Refrigerated Bagels Offer?

The unique flavors of refrigerated bagels provide a delightful twist on the classic breakfast staple.

  • Everything Bagel: This flavor combines a mix of sesame seeds, poppy seeds, garlic, onion, and salt, creating a savory and aromatic profile that pairs well with cream cheese or hummus.
  • Cinnamon Raisin Bagel: Infused with sweet cinnamon and plump raisins, this bagel offers a delightful balance of sweetness and spice, making it a perfect choice for breakfast or a snack.
  • Cheddar Jalapeño Bagel: For those who enjoy a bit of heat, this bagel combines sharp cheddar cheese with the spiciness of jalapeños, resulting in a bold flavor that is delicious toasted with butter.
  • Blueberry Bagel: Made with real blueberries, this flavor provides a sweet, fruity taste that is great for breakfast or as a sweet treat, especially when paired with cream cheese.
  • Sesame Bagel: With a nutty flavor from toasted sesame seeds, this bagel is versatile and can be enjoyed with a variety of spreads, from savory to sweet.
  • Onion Bagel: This bagel features a rich onion flavor that is both savory and satisfying, making it an excellent choice for sandwiches or with a simple smear of cream cheese.
  • Spinach Feta Bagel: Combining spinach and feta cheese, this flavor delivers a Mediterranean twist that is both healthy and tasty, ideal for those looking for a nutritious option.

How Can You Prepare Refrigerated Bagels for Maximum Flavor?

To maximize the flavor of refrigerated bagels, consider the following preparation methods:

  • Toasting: Toasting bagels enhances their flavor and texture, providing a crispy exterior while keeping the inside soft. The heat helps to bring out the bagel’s natural flavors and creates a delightful contrast that many enjoy.
  • Heating in the Oven: Reheating bagels in the oven allows for a more evenly distributed warmth and can create a crispy crust. Preheat the oven to a moderate temperature, wrap the bagel in foil to retain moisture, and heat for about 10-15 minutes for the best results.
  • Using a Skillet: A skillet can give bagels a delicious, crispy bottom while keeping the top soft. Simply heat a small amount of butter or oil in the skillet over medium heat, place the bagel cut side down, and cook until golden brown.
  • Adding Toppings: Elevating your bagel with flavorful toppings such as cream cheese, avocado, or smoked salmon can significantly enhance the overall taste experience. Experimenting with different spreads and toppings can also introduce new flavors that complement the bagel.
  • Microwaving with a Damp Paper Towel: If you’re short on time, microwaving the bagel with a damp paper towel can quickly restore moisture. This method softens the bagel but may not provide the crispy texture some prefer; it’s best for a quick fix.

What Tips Ensure the Freshness of Refrigerated Bagels in Your Kitchen?

To ensure the freshness of refrigerated bagels, consider the following tips:

  • Store in an Airtight Container: Using an airtight container helps to prevent moisture loss and keeps the bagels from drying out. This method also protects them from absorbing any odors from the refrigerator, which can affect their flavor.
  • Wrap in Plastic Wrap or Aluminum Foil: Wrapping bagels individually in plastic wrap or aluminum foil creates a barrier against air and moisture. This technique minimizes exposure to the elements that can lead to staleness, helping to maintain their soft texture.
  • Freeze for Long-Term Storage: If you don’t plan to consume your refrigerated bagels within a few days, consider freezing them. Freezing bagels preserves their freshness for a much longer period, and you can toast them directly from the freezer when ready to eat.
  • Keep Away from Strong Odors: Bagels can easily absorb strong odors from other foods in the refrigerator. To prevent this, store them away from pungent items, or use a container specifically designated for bagels to maintain their flavor.
  • Consume Within a Week: Even when stored properly, refrigerated bagels are best consumed within a week. This timeframe helps ensure they retain their optimal taste and texture, as prolonged refrigeration may still lead to staleness.
